    I am pretty certain from reading forum that I have error code 1 – after power on LED 2 flashes for 30 seconds, pump starts then dial clicks round with 1 flash repeating once per “dot”.

    Can anybody tell me meaning of error code 1 or if I am on the wrong track.

    If its any use – I’ve tested temperature sensor – responds to change in temp with resistance change. Motor brushes seem ok and water fill relay changes over.

    Can you give us the correct model number as opposed to its name, these machines are either a 100{e5d1b7155a01ef1f3b9c9968eaba33524ee81600d00d4be2b4d93ac2e58cec2d} Indesit clone ( bad news) or a Hotpoint based machine with Indesit electronics ( not much better news). The timer clicking round suggests an Indesit clone. When the timer clicks round the neon will flash then pause, however the control will keep on clicking round until you stop it.

    If you do have error code 1 then that infers a short circuited triac, a faulty module in other words.

    Sadly that is an Indesit clone. 😥 There is a possibility that something has caused the triac to fail. Even the Indesit engineers themselves do not posess full control board circuitry information.

    Two different modules depending on serial number at around £70 + vat they come without the eeprom which is around £8.50 + vat. A full check of all other components and wiring would be need to make certain that the triac in question has not been damaged by one of them.

    Given the quality and reliability :rolls: of this model range you may want to consider your next move with great circumspection.
